summaryrefslogtreecommitdiffstats
path: root/include
diff options
context:
space:
mode:
authorBrijesh Singh <brijesh.singh@amd.com>2022-04-26 17:31:13 +0000
committerSuravee Suthikulpanit <suravee.suthikulpanit@amd.com>2022-07-13 17:27:25 -0500
commitab2883dcac131dc50a984d3cbb4e15f296272242 (patch)
tree6c7590beb369c27404d6c970f820de9953a6bcda /include
parentfab81bc5030dcb8e50ad4d8e9cd2cb1a4983e55a (diff)
downloadcachepc-linux-ab2883dcac131dc50a984d3cbb4e15f296272242.tar.gz
cachepc-linux-ab2883dcac131dc50a984d3cbb4e15f296272242.zip
x86/sev: Add helper functions for RMPUPDATE and PSMASH instruction
The RMPUPDATE instruction writes a new RMP entry in the RMP Table. The hypervisor will use the instruction to add pages to the RMP table. See APM3 for details on the instruction operations. The PSMASH instruction expands a 2MB RMP entry into a corresponding set of contiguous 4KB-Page RMP entries. The hypervisor will use this instruction to adjust the RMP entry without invalidating the previous RMP entry. Signed-off-by: Brijesh Singh <brijesh.singh@amd.com>
Diffstat (limited to 'include')
0 files changed, 0 insertions, 0 deletions